Venue choice
Ideal choices for residential meeting or residential training venues are resorts or large hotels a little away from the city. Venues like these not only make the entire program more interesting but they also isolate the participants from their daily lives thus enabling them to focus on the activities and events on hand. Venues outside the city also have a great relaxing factor added to them and therefore make for a pleasant change of scene.
Activities
Well planned activities are crucial to the any residential program. Besides the meetings and training modules that you have as part of your agenda, you should also take advantage of such an opportunity to strengthen the bonds between your employees by organising structured team building activities. You should also factor in some fun time for the participants to let their hair down. While short listing residential meeting venues you should make sure that the venue you choose has ample space for all these activities at your disposal.
Accommodation
Accommodation is also another important aspect that you have to consider very carefully while choosing residential meeting or residential training venues. You should make sure that the accommodation that the venue is offering you has all the amenities that you think would be necessary for your participants in order for them to have a comfortable stay even if it is on a sharing basis.
